KRW Information

The KRW (South Korean Won) is South Korea’s currency, with coins (₩1, ₩5, ₩10, ₩50, ₩100, ₩500) and bills (₩1,000, ₩5,000, ₩10,000, ₩50,000). The ₩50,000 note honors Shin Saimdang, a rare female figure on currency—explore it at the Bank of Korea.

ETH Information

Ethereum (ETH) is a decentralized cryptocurrency introduced in 2015 by Vitalik Buterin. It powers smart contracts and dApps, with units like wei and gwei. Its blockchain hosts NFTs and DeFi—dive into it at Ethereum.org.
